When you call to discuss your sliding door project, several factors influence the final estimate. The overall size of the opening and the material you choose—such as vinyl, aluminum, or wood—are primary drivers. We also look at whether you need a standard replacement or a custom configuration that requires structural modifications to the frame. The type of glass, including energy-efficient dual-pane or impact-resistant options, also impacts the total.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
Installation costs are determined by how much labor is needed to remove your old door and prep the space for the new one. If the existing subfloor or surrounding wall needs repair, this adds time to the job. We evaluate the specific site conditions to ensure a smooth, energy-efficient fit.
